Abstract

The utility model discloses a connectable bolt which comprises a bolt, wherein a fixed rod is fixedly installed at the right end of the bolt, threads are arranged on the outer wall of the fixed rod, a nut is connected to the outer wall of the bolt in a threaded manner, the left end of the outer wall of the fixed rod is sleeved with an elastic gasket, a first nut is connected to the outer wall of the fixed rod in a threaded manner, a second nut is connected to the outer wall of the fixed rod in a threaded manner, and a connecting assembly is arranged at the right end of the fixed rod. The utility model relates to the technical field of bolts, and solves the problem that the bolt is limited in use due to the fact that the bolt length is fixed and cannot meet the fixing requirement frequently in use.

Referring to fig. 1-4, the present invention provides a technical solution: the utility model provides a bolt of joinable, includes bolt 1, and bolt 1's right-hand member fixed mounting has dead lever 2, and the outer wall of dead lever 2 is provided with the screw thread, and bolt 1's outer wall spiro union has nut 3, and dead lever 2 obtains the outer wall left end and has cup jointed elastic gasket 4, and the outer wall spiro union of dead lever 2 has first nut 5, and the outer wall spiro union of dead lever 2 has second nut 6, and the right-hand member of dead lever 2 is provided with coupling assembling.
It should be noted that, the first nut 5 and the second nut 6 are screwed on the outer wall of the fixing rod 2, so that the single bolt 1 can exert a normal fastening function, the first nut 5 can be stably screwed on the outer wall of the fixing rod 2 by the arrangement of the second nut 6, the first nut 5 can receive the elastic function of the elastic gasket 4 by the arrangement of the elastic gasket 4 when being screwed on the outer wall of the fixing rod 2, so that the thread of the first nut 5 is tightly contacted with the thread on the outer wall of the fixing rod 2, so that the friction between the two is increased, the first nut 5 is stably screwed on the outer wall of the fixing rod 2, the two bolts 1 can be stably connected together by the arrangement of the connecting component, so that the bolt 1 can be suitable for fixing various objects, and the two bolts 1 can be prevented from being completely separated when being loosened, the stability in use is improved.
Preferably, the connecting assembly further includes two telescopic assemblies, a threaded hole 11 and a fixing hole 12, the two telescopic assemblies are respectively disposed on the front and rear sides of the fixing rod 2, the threaded hole 11 is disposed at the left end of the fixing rod 2, and the fixing hole 12 is disposed at the right end of the threaded hole 11.

Preferably, one end of the latch 9 is inclined, so that the inclined surface of the latch 9 is contracted to the inner cavity of the telescopic cavity 7 after being pressed.
Preferably, the outer wall of the bolt 1 is plated with a zinc layer, so that the service life of the bolt 1 is prolonged.
Preferably, the thread on the inner wall of the threaded hole 11 is matched with the thread on the outer wall of the fixing rod 2, so that the fixing rod 2 can be screwed in the inner cavity of the threaded hole 11, and the two bolts 1 can be stably connected together.
When two bolts 1 are required to be spliced together, the first nut 5 and the second nut 6 are taken down, one end of the fixing rod 2 is inserted into the inner cavity of the threaded hole 11, and then the two clamping blocks 9 drive the sliding block 8 to contract into the inner cavity of the telescopic cavity 7, so that the spring 10 is elastically deformed, at the moment, the fixing rod 2 is rotated to enable the fixing rod 2 to be in threaded connection with the inner cavity of the threaded hole 11, so that one end of the fixing rod 2 extends to the inner cavity of the fixing hole 12, at the moment, the original position is rapidly restored under the action of the elastic force of the spring 10, the clamping blocks 9 are clamped in the inner cavity of the fixing hole 12, when the fixing rod 2 is loosened, the two bolts 1 are prevented from being completely separated, the purpose of stably connecting the two bolts 1 together is achieved, the use is convenient, the two bolts 1 can also be prevented from being completely separated, and the first nut 5 and the second nut 6 are in threaded connection with the outer wall of the fixing rod 2, can make solitary bolt 1 can exert normal fastening effect, setting through second nut 6 can make the stable spiro union of first nut 5 at the outer wall of dead lever 2, setting through elasticity gasket 4 can make first nut 5 when the spiro union is at the outer wall of dead lever 2, can receive the elasticity effect of elasticity gasket 4, thereby make the screw thread of first nut 5 and 2 outer wall screw threads in close contact with of dead lever, thereby make the frictional force increase between the two, make the stable spiro union of first nut 5 at the outer wall of dead lever 2.
